Z Hotel Soho Offers Urbanite Stay in Central London
A brand new hotel concept, Z Hotels offer high quality short stay accommodation in city centre locations, at an affordable price.

What they’ve done here is amalgamated twelve Georgian townhouses, connected them together with a series of hi-tech walkways, and created 85 rooms clustered round a central courtyard. This is designer chic in a compact, high-quality environment and, of course, squeezing a quart into a pint pot has its implications. The room are small but perfectly formed, with quartzite and glass finishes in the en-suite bathroom, and wood panelling on the walls. There’s a bed and a telly but no room for much else.
And if you think about it that’s perfectly OK. The idea is that you stay in the heart of the West End and, apart from sleeping, you’re out and about dipping into London’s garden of earthly delights. This is the concept they’re calling the “Urbanite Stay” – you spend no more than two nights in a prime city centre location in a room offering the highest quality, at an affordable price. 40” LED HD TV’s with free Sky Sports and Sky Movies, power showers, bespoke hand-crafted beds, i-docking stations, and free Wi-Fi are all offered as standard. Just don’t bring too much luggage.
As you’d expect in such a compact environment, there’s not a lot of space for the traditional hotel lobby but there’s an open air courtyard on the first floor which, in the summer months, will be great for lounging. Downstairs there’s the 24 hour Z Café, a welcome oasis in the hustle and bustle of Soho, perfect for a coffee or a glass of champagne. The food’s pretty good too, the kitchen specialising in salads and light bites.
